Job Description
Treasury Analyst
CookUnity
• Perform daily, weekly, and monthly payments and credit card reconciliations to ensure accurate recording of transactions. • Manage daily cash position reporting and checkpoints to ensure alignment with planned burn rate and financial targets. • Assist in the preparation and maintenance of short- and medium-term cash flow forecasts. • Execute weekly payment processes, including vendor payments and employee reimbursements. • Serve as a point of contact for vendors regarding payment inquiries, resolving issues accurately and promptly. • Support vendor onboarding by creating and maintaining vendor records in the accounting system. • Partner with the Treasury Manager on treasury-related initiatives, reporting, and special projects. • Review and support vendor credit applications and related documentation. • Identify opportunities to improve treasury processes, controls, and scalability. • Adapt quickly to changing priorities and assist with additional treasury-related responsibilities as needed.
Job Requirements
- Proven experience (+2 years) in treasury, finance, or accounting roles, with a focus on cash management and treasury operations, preferably in a fast-growing company.
- Familiarity with treasury tools, ERP/accounting systems, or AP platforms (e.g., NetSuite/Ramp).
- Advanced English Skills
- Excellent analytical skills and attention to detail to ensure accuracy in financial data.
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, startup environment with shifting priorities.
- Effective communicator and team player capable of collaborating remotely.
- Self-motivated, adaptable, and proactive with a positive attitude.
- Experience in handling stressful situations calmly and effectively.
